MAURICIO POCHETTINO COULD SELL £60M PLAYER CHELSEA SIGNED LAST SUMMER
The Sun have reported that among the Chelsea players Mauricio Pochettino could decide to offload at the end of the season is Marc Cucurella.
The report has claimed that former Tottenham Hotspur head coach Pochettino is on the verge of becoming the new Chelsea boss.
The Sun have claimed that left-back Cucurella “is among those who could be sold”.
The 24-year-old Spain international joined Chelsea from Brighton and Hove Albion in the summer of 2022.
According to Sky Sports, Chelsea paid £60 million in transfer fees for Cucurella.
The report claimed that Manchester City wanted to sign the Spaniard as well, but it was Chelsea who got the deal done.
Incoming Chelsea manager Mauricio Pochettino shouldn’t sell Marc Cucurella
Cucurella has not had a good season at Chelsea.
The left-back has made 21 starts and three substitute appearances in the Premier League for the Blues this campaign.
The Spain international, who was slammed by former Liverpool defender and Sky Sports pundit Jamie Carragher earlier in the season, has given two assists in those games
Cucurella also made four starts and four substitute appearances in the UEFA Champions League, and played once in the Carabao Cup for Chelsea this campaign.
We do not think that Pochettino should sell the left-back in the summer of 2023.
Yes, the left-back has not had a good campaign, but Chelsea as a team have struggled.
We think that Pochettino should give Cucurella a chance next season.
